Call for Proposals: Joan Schafer Research Faculty Award in Sport, Fitness, and Disability


Joan Schafer Research Faculty Award in Sport, Fitness, and Disability
Application Deadline July 31, 2017
The Joan Schafer Research Faculty Award in Sport, Fitness, and Disability, established in 2015, provides up to $5,000 for projects investigating how living with a physical challenge influences access to and participation in sport and physical activity. Projects that have real world application are a top funding priority. This grant supports both theoretical as well as intervention research, including challenges and solutions related to transitioning to civilian life from military service.
Support may be requested for individual activities, such as research assistance, research-related travel, or research materials. We support collaborative projects, pilot studies or initial research efforts. While providing funds for new and emerging work is a priority for this program, requests for support of ongoing programs of research are also considered. Applications accepted from all academic disciplines.
